写出密码验证三次错误


以下是一个用 Python 实现密码验证三次错误的示例代码: ```python password = "123456" # 假设正确密码 attempts = 0 # 记录尝试次数 while attempts < 3: user_input = input("请输入密码: ") if user_input == password: print("密码正确,登录成功!") break else: print("密码错误,请重新输入。") attempts += 1 if attempts == 3: print("错误次数达到三次,账号已锁定。") ``` 额外需要注意的逻辑点: 1. 实际应用中,密码应进行加密存储,不能以明文形式。 2. 可以增加输入错误后的等待时间,防止暴力破解。 3. 考虑添加日志记录功能,记录每次输入的情况。 [2025-01-08 17:55:21 | AI写代码神器 | 191点数解答]
相关提问
- 用octave1.在钢线碳含量对于电阻的效应研究中,得到如下数据分别用一次、三次、五次多项式拟 合曲线来拟合这组数据并画出图形. 碳含量x 0.10 0.30 0.40 0.55 0.70 0.80 0.95 电阳y 15 18 19 21 22.6 23.8 26 2.已知在某实验室中测得某质点的位移S和速度以随时间变化如下: t 0 0.5 1.0 1.5 2.0 2.5 3.0 ν 0 0.4794 0.815 0.9975 0.9093 0.5985 0.1411 s 1 1.5 2 2.5 3 3.5 4(340点数解答 | 2025-03-25 19:14:33)109
- 错误 8800:发生了常规 Photoshop 错误。该功能可能无法在这个版本的Photoshop 中使用。命令"<未知的>"当前不可用。直线: 38>executeAction(charlDToTypelD("Hr "),hueSaturationDescDialogModes.NO);(349点数解答 | 2025-02-28 11:19:16)330
- objects = selection as array if objects.count == 0 then ( messagebox "请先选择一个或多个模型" title:"错误" ) -- 创建CSV文件 csvPath = "C:\\sers\\ASUS\\Desktop" csvFile = createfile csvPath if (csvFile == undefined) do ( messagebox "无法创建CSV文件" title:"错误" ) -- 导出模型长度数据 format "Name,Length\n" to:csvFile for obj in objects do ( objName = obj.name objLength = obj.max format "%,%\n" objName objLength to:csvFile ) -- 导出成功提示 format "模型长度已成功导出到CSV文件:%.\n" csvPath messagebox "模型长度已成功(525点数解答 | 2025-07-09 15:37:45)66
- 写出“传播中国故事”微信小程序的代码(1119点数解答 | 2024-06-21 22:07:18)176
- 写出《将进酒》的内容,并排好版,方便打印(233点数解答 | 2024-09-25 20:51:55)152
- 7-3 验证“哥德巴赫猜想” 分数 10 简单 作者 徐镜春 单位 浙江大学 数学领域著名的“哥德巴赫猜想”的大致意思是:任何一个大于2的偶数总能表示为两个素数之和。比如:24=5+19,其中5和19都是素数。本实验的任务是设计一个程序,验证20亿以内的偶数都可以分解成两个素数之和。 输入格式: 输入在一行中给出一个(2, 2 000 000 000]范围内的偶数n。 输出格式: 在一行中按照格式“n = p + q”输出n的素数分解,其中p ≤ q均为素数。又因为这样的分解不唯一(例如24还可以分解为7+17),要求必须输出所有解中p最小的解。 输入样例: 24 输出样例: 24 = 5 + 19(667点数解答 | 2024-11-11 19:20:44)373
- 7-16 验证“哥德巴赫猜想” 分数 20 作者 徐镜春 单位 浙江大学 数学领域著名的“哥德巴赫猜想”的大致意思是:任何一个大于2的偶数总能表示为两个素数之和。比如:24=5+19,其中5和19都是素数。本实验的任务是设计一个程序,验证20亿以内的偶数都可以分解成两个素数之和。 输入格式: 输入在一行中给出一个(2, 2 000 000 000]范围内的偶数n。 输出格式: 在一行中按照格式“n = p + q”输出n的素数分解,其中p ≤ q均为素数。又因为这样的分解不唯一(例如24还可以分解为7+17),要求必须输出所有解中p最小的解。 输入样例:(18点数解答 | 2024-11-13 20:44:46)183
- 7-13 验证“哥德巴赫猜想” 分数 9 作者 徐镜春 单位 浙江大学 数学领域著名的“哥德巴赫猜想”的大致意思是:任何一个大于2的偶数总能表示为两个素数之和。比如:24=5+19,其中5和19都是素数。本实验的任务是设计一个程序,验证20亿以内的偶数都可以分解成两个素数之和。 输入格式: 输入在一行中给出一个(2, 2 000 000 000]范围内的偶数n。 输出格式: 在一行中按照格式“n = p + q”输出n的素数分解,其中p ≤ q均为素数。又因为这样的分解不唯一(例如24还可以分解为7+17),要求必须输出所有解中p最小的解。 输入样例: 24 输出样例: 24 = 5 + 19(210点数解答 | 2024-11-15 00:26:05)260
- 7-13 验证“哥德巴赫猜想” 分数 9 作者 徐镜春 单位 浙江大学 数学领域著名的“哥德巴赫猜想”的大致意思是:任何一个大于2的偶数总能表示为两个素数之和。比如:24=5+19,其中5和19都是素数。本实验的任务是设计一个程序,验证20亿以内的偶数都可以分解成两个素数之和。 输入格式: 输入在一行中给出一个(2, 2 000 000 000]范围内的偶数n。 输出格式: 在一行中按照格式“n = p + q”输出n的素数分解,其中p ≤ q均为素数。又因为这样的分解不唯一(例如24还可以分解为7+17),要求必须输出所有解中p最小的解。 输入样例: 24 输出样例: 24 = 5 + 19,请用c语言来编写(206点数解答 | 2024-11-15 00:27:23)140
- 改写“一个网站为了使自己的网站有固定的客户群,方便对用户的管理,一般都具有会员注册的功能。会员注册的操作是很简单的,在主页面有会员管理模块,用户很容易就可以找到,点击注册按钮,便进入会员注册的模块。在注册过程中,有些信息是要求用户必须填写的,如:用户名、密码、电子邮箱等。而且这些信息的格式有严格的验证,不附和要求的信息是不可以进入注册的下一步的,如:用户名不能为空、密码验证不相符等”(138点数解答 | 2024-03-06 17:37:05)201
- 注册功能1 编写一个注册应用程序,要求: 1.注册项目至少包括:姓名、性别、年龄、兴趣爱好、密码。 2.注册信息能够正确提交到注册用servlet中,可以使用控制台打印注册信息。 3.注册信息不能出现乱码。(2286点数解答 | 2024-04-02 14:54:20)218
- 编写带有验证码功能的用户登录程序 完成带有验证码功能的用户登录程序。要求: 1.登录项包括:用户名、密码、验证码。其中,验证码需要显示在页面上。 2.用户登录时,程序要验证用户输入的验证码是否正确,并给出对应的提示。 3.要求使用httpsession完成功能,即:验证码要放在httpsession中。 4.验证码使用一次后即销毁。(1826点数解答 | 2024-04-22 16:44:01)196